
Visual C++.NET百例教程:进阶小游戏开发技巧

根据提供的文件信息,我们可以确定以下IT知识点:
标题中提到的是《Visual C++.NET小游戏开发时尚编程百例》这本书。Visual C++ .NET是微软推出的一个C++开发环境,是Visual Studio的一个重要组成部分。它允许开发者使用C++语言进行Windows应用程序的开发,并且整合了.NET Framework。这本书通过100个实际案例来教授读者如何使用Visual C++ .NET进行小游戏的开发,这个系列的实例是分两部分上传的,其中第二部分涉及实例51到100。
从描述中我们可以看出,这本书涵盖了实际的编程例子,而且资源量较大,这表明书中可能包含了详细的源码、项目设置、步骤说明以及可能的调试方法。因为资源较大,所以需要分两次上传,这说明该书内容丰富,对于想学习Visual C++ .NET小游戏开发的人来说,这是一本具有相当实用性的指导书。
标签中的“vc”指的是Visual C++,这表明该书聚焦于使用Visual C++作为开发工具,而“源码”则表明书中包含具体的编程代码,这是学习编程最直接的材料。“随书光盘”暗示除了书本内容外,还可能提供一张包含所有实例代码、可能的视频教程、工具以及相关辅助文件的光盘,这对于学习和实践是极大的帮助。
从文件名称列表中,我们知道具体要讨论的是实例51到100。这意味着学习者可以期待在第二部分中看到一些进阶或者更加复杂的游戏编程例子,这些例子可能涉及更高级的编程概念,如多线程、图形用户界面(GUI)的构建、声音效果的处理、网络编程以及可能的数据库交互等。这些知识点对于学习如何开发一个具有丰富功能的小游戏至关重要。
根据上述分析,我们可以得出以下详细知识点:
1. Visual C++ .NET开发环境概述:解释Visual C++ .NET是什么,它的特点以及它在.NET开发中的作用。
2. 使用Visual C++ .NET开发小游戏的入门知识:介绍如何使用Visual Studio创建C++项目,设置项目属性,编写和调试代码。
3. 实例分析:从实例51到100,逐步讲解各个游戏案例的设计思路、结构、关键代码段以及实现过程中遇到的常见问题和解决方案。
4. C++编程基础:涵盖C++语法、面向对象编程(OOP)概念、异常处理、内存管理等基础内容,为编写小游戏提供必要的编程技能。
5. 游戏逻辑开发:介绍如何使用C++实现游戏逻辑,包括游戏循环、状态管理、输入处理和游戏物理等。
6. 图形和多媒体应用:深入探讨如何在Visual C++ .NET中集成图形界面,使用DirectX或其他图形库进行游戏渲染,以及添加声音效果。
7. 高级技术应用:在实例51至100中可能包含更多高级主题,比如多线程游戏编程、网络通信、数据库交互,以及如何构建多人在线游戏。
8. 调试与性能优化:讨论如何调试C++代码,识别并解决性能瓶颈,确保游戏运行流畅无误。
9. 实践案例的总结和扩展:鼓励学习者在掌握书中知识的基础上,进行自己的创新和扩展,从而制作出更个性化的游戏项目。
10. 附录资源的使用方法:包括源码的使用、光盘中工具的安装和使用,以及如何将它们整合到自己的开发环境中。
通过对以上知识点的学习,读者不仅能够掌握Visual C++ .NET小游戏开发的技巧,还可以在实践中加深对编程概念的理解,最终能够独立开发出属于自己的小游戏。
相关推荐






xixiahouyi
- 粉丝: 4
最新资源
- 探索JavaPetStore 2.0-EA5版本的新特性
- 宾馆管理系统源码及其功能介绍
- Oracle11i中文版帮助文档全套资料下载
- 超轻量级PDF阅读器:小巧高效阅读体验
- C#实现的新邮件提醒工具教程
- 升级版Flex技术:HTML嵌入实例详解
- 走迷宫与八皇后问题的解法与资料集锦
- 网上购物系统设计与实现
- 手机视频格式快速转换工具推荐
- XMLDOM对象方法手册:JavaScript中的XML处理指南
- 深入浅出:西财概率论与数理统计教学资源
- 跨平台Unicode文件读写操作指南
- 批处理打造IP切换器:简化网络配置
- JSP常用基础语法及帮助文档解析
- Winsock通讯原理及简易服务器客户端代码
- PHP面向对象编程规范详解
- 网络管理员必备:远程批量修改密码与执行程序工具
- JAVA EE 5英文版官方API文档精要
- 数据库实验报告:全面分析与参考指南
- Java存取LOB数据至Sybase数据库的三种Spring实现方式
- Robert C. Martin著《清晰的代码》英文PDF下载
- DebugView:高效浏览调试信息的工具
- C++实现动态增减功能的带菜单窗口程序
- SSH框架开发的学生信息管理系统功能介绍